## Runbook: Ostermill zero-downtime migrations

Order: expand schema, deploy dual-write code, backfill, verify counts, cut reads over, contract. Never contract in the same release as expand. Backfill runs in 10k-row batches; pause if replica lag exceeds 5s. Rollback is safe until the contract step only. Migration bundles must be signed before the runner accepts them; current release uses the key below.

release key, badug-bagag: bky9_WpxzpRubJ

## Releases

Crumbline enforces the bakery order-cutoff rule (orders after 14:00 local roll to next day) in the `cutoff-core` module. Each release must be tagged, and the cutoff table regenerated from `schedules/ovens.toml` before building, since stale tables have caused double-baked batches twice this quarter. Verify the migration checksum matches the release notes, then run the full regression suite in the staging bakery simulator. Once green, sign the artifact for the Millbrook depot using the deploy key that follows.

rollout seal: bky4_yke3

The fix adjusts the refresh cutoff and adds regression coverage in the token lifecycle suite. Release managers should confirm that the staging soak completes the full 24-hour window before promotion. Every promoted artifact must be signed and verified against the current release key, provided below.

signing key of bagap-yawep = bky13_TbfT6ZMUoGJo2

// Fixture: driver-assignment heuristic regression cases (Project Kerbwise)
// Heads up: these cases pin the greedy fallback that kicks in when the
// zone-balancing solver times out. If assignments start clustering on one
// depot at 2am, it's almost always this path, not the solver itself.
// The fixture replays real-ish dispatch snapshots against the staging
// matcher, so don't run it against prod config. To pull fresh snapshots
// from the staging feed, authenticate with the token below.

session JWT of yawep-yawep = eyJhbGciOiJIUzI1NiIsInR5cCI6IkpXVCJ9.eyJzdWIiOiI3pWF3_In0.aXYsHiog